Visualizar

Diferença entre “Visão” e “Visão Materializada”

Diferença entre “Visão” e “Visão Materializada”

A diferença básica entre Visualização e Visualização Materializada é que as Visualizações não são armazenadas fisicamente no disco. Por outro lado, as visualizações materializadas são armazenadas no disco. A visão pode ser definida como uma tabela virtual criada como resultado da expressão de consulta.

  1. Qual é a melhor visão ou visão materializada?
  2. Qual é a diferença entre visão normal e visão materializada?
  3. Qual é o propósito da visão materializada?
  4. Por que a visão materializada é mais rápida?
  5. Qual é a visão mais rápida ou visão materializada?
  6. O que é visão materializada com exemplo?
  7. Como você mantém a visão materializada?
  8. A visualização é mais rápida do que a consulta mysql?
  9. O que se entende por visão materializada?
  10. Podemos criar índices em visualizações?
  11. O que é visão materializada em Snowflake?
  12. Podemos executar DML na visão materializada?

Qual é a melhor visão ou visão materializada?

Quando vemos o desempenho da visão materializada, é melhor do que a visão normal porque os dados da visão materializada serão armazenados na tabela e a tabela pode ser indexada de forma mais rápida para a união também é feita no momento da atualização das visões materializadas, então não há necessidade de toda vez que disparar a instrução de junção como no caso de vista.

Qual é a diferença entre visão normal e visão materializada?

Uma visão usa uma consulta para extrair dados das tabelas subjacentes. Uma visão materializada é uma tabela em disco que contém o conjunto de resultados de uma consulta. ... As visualizações materializadas podem ser atualizadas regularmente por meio de gatilhos ou usando a opção ON COMMIT REFRESH.

Qual é o propósito da visão materializada?

A Oracle usa visualizações materializadas (também conhecidas como instantâneos em versões anteriores) para replicar dados para sites não mestres em um ambiente de replicação e para armazenar em cache consultas caras em um ambiente de data warehouse.

Por que a visão materializada é mais rápida?

Então, aqui vem as visualizações materializadas que nos ajudam a obter dados mais rapidamente. ... Uma tabela pode precisar de código adicional para truncar / recarregar dados. exemplo: a visão materializada com dados de várias tabelas pode ser configurada para atualizar automaticamente fora do horário de pico. Uma tabela física precisaria de código adicional para truncar / recarregar dados.

Qual é a visão mais rápida ou visão materializada?

Uma visão é sempre atualizada à medida que a visão que cria a consulta é executada cada vez que a visão é usada. ... A visualização materializada responde mais rápido do que a visualização, pois a visualização materializada é pré-computada. A visualização materializada utiliza o espaço da memória conforme está armazenado no disco, enquanto a visualização é apenas uma exibição, portanto, não requer espaço de memória.

O que é visão materializada com exemplo?

Diferença entre visualização materializada e visualização:

VisualizarVisualizações materializadas (instantâneos)
1. A visão nada mais é do que a estrutura lógica da tabela que irá recuperar dados de uma ou mais tabelas.1. Visualizações materializadas (instantâneos) também são estruturas lógicas, mas os dados são armazenados fisicamente no banco de dados.
• 4 лют. 2017 р.

Como você mantém a visão materializada?

Para fins de replicação, as visualizações materializadas permitem que você mantenha cópias de dados remotos em seu nó local.
...
CLÁUSULA DE ATUALIZAÇÃO

  1. O método de atualização usado pela Oracle para atualizar os dados na visão materializada.
  2. Se a visualização é baseada em chave primária ou baseada em id de linha.
  3. A hora e o intervalo em que a visualização deve ser atualizada.

A visualização é mais rápida do que a consulta mysql?

Não, uma visualização é simplesmente uma consulta de texto armazenada. Você pode aplicar WHERE e ORDER contra ele, o plano de execução será calculado com essas cláusulas levadas em consideração.

O que se entende por visão materializada?

Uma visão materializada é um objeto de banco de dados que contém os resultados de uma consulta. ... Você pode selecionar dados de uma visão materializada como faria em uma tabela ou visão. Em ambientes de replicação, as visualizações materializadas comumente criadas são visualizações materializadas de chave primária, rowid, objeto e subconsulta.

Podemos criar índices em visualizações?

O primeiro índice criado em uma exibição deve ser um índice clusterizado exclusivo. ... A criação de um índice clusterizado exclusivo em uma exibição melhora o desempenho da consulta porque a exibição é armazenada no banco de dados da mesma forma que uma tabela com um índice clusterizado é armazenada. O otimizador de consulta pode usar visualizações indexadas para acelerar a execução da consulta.

O que é visão materializada em Snowflake?

Snowflake oferece a você um novo recurso geralmente disponível: Snowflake Materialized Views and Maintenance (Snowflake MVs). Uma visão materializada (MV) é um objeto de banco de dados que contém os resultados de uma consulta. Ao contrário de uma visualização, não é uma janela para um banco de dados.

Podemos executar DML na visão materializada?

Uma visão materializada pode ser somente leitura, atualizável ou gravável. Os usuários não podem executar instruções de linguagem de manipulação de dados (DML) em visualizações materializadas somente leitura, mas podem executar DML em visualizações materializadas atualizáveis ​​e graváveis.

Capital One Quicksilver vs. Chase Freedom
Qual é melhor Chase Freedom ou Capital One Quicksilver?Qual é o melhor cartão de crédito chase ou Capital One?O Capital One Quicksilver é um bom cartã...
Diferença entre plastificante e superplastificante
Os superplastificantes (SP's), também conhecidos como redutores de água de alto alcance, são aditivos usados ​​na fabricação de concreto de alta resis...
Qual é a diferença entre sinérgica e óvulo
A principal diferença entre a sinérgica e a célula-ovo é que a sinérgica é um tipo de célula de suporte no saco embrionário, enquanto a célula-ovo é o...